MALG member the Money Advice Trust has worked in partnership with the Money and Mental Health Policy Institute to create a debt and mental health fact sheet for its National Debtline and Business Debtline money advice services. New research from the Institute of Fiscal Studies has found that men from poor backgrounds have lower earnings and are twice as likely to be single as those from rich families. MALG member Accountant in Bankruptcy (AiB) has called on everyone involved in the insolvency and debt management processes to voice their opinions on the mechanism used to determine how much debtors pay towards their debts. MALG member the Money Advice Service has announced that Shelter will be the supplier to deliver a three-year contract for specialist debt advice support services on its behalf.
